DeLiViewer

Менеджер Liveinternet статистики

Остальные программы - это громко сказано :) Но если вы это читаете - значит сюда заглянули. Из своих остальных программ в паблик я выложил пока две - софт, помогающий делать уникальные картинки и многопоточную программу прогона по дженах ресурсам.




myImageGenerator

Генератор уникальных картинок на основе HTML шаблона. Создает уникальные, тематические, хорошо вписывающиеся в любой дизайн картинки.

Программа складывает воедино все созданные в ней слои. Каждый слой имеет свою структуру в виде HTML разметки и относящегося к этому слою набору CSS стилей. Как в слое, так и в его стиле можно использовать макрос вариации. Чем больше вариаций - тем больше итоговых изображений получится. Слоев и их вариантов может быть неограниченное количество. 

 В программе всегда будет один не удаляемый слой "Настройки фона" - подразумевается что в нем будут описаны фоновые настройки будущих изображений. 

Рядом со слоем в квадратных скобках будет количество получившихся вариантов этого самого слоя с учетом его стилей.

На рисунке (слева или выше, в зависимости от верстки) пример простой проекта логотипа сайта этого генератора. Как видно - фон имеет 2 варианта, основная надпись myImageGenerator имеет 12 вариантов и 4 варианта надписи домена www.myrecordbook.ru (4 варианта расположения надписи на рисунке, в четырех углах,так к слову). 

В итоге имеем 96 вариантов почти одинаковых (но всеже разных) картинок. Проект для примера можно скачть по этой ссылке.

Важный момент - программа использует в работе встроенный в Windows компонент IExplorer. По умолчанию в системе стоит устаревшая версия этого компонента. Программа будет работать, но все прелести CSS3 будут недоступны. По возможности, установите Internet Explorer последней версии.

Но даже если установлен Explorer последней версии, система все равно подсовывает старый, пока не внести разрешения для использования в реестр. В этом случае при первом запуске программа попросит вас внести изменения в реестр.

Для активации возможностей CSS3 в программе, пропишите в реесте 

HKEY_LOCAL_MACHINE (или HKEY_CURRENT_USER)
                                                           SOFTWARE
                                                              Microsoft
                                                                 Internet Explorer
                                                                    Main
                                                                       FeatureControl
                                                                          FEATURE_BROWSER_EMULATION
                                                                             myImageGenerator.exe = (DWORD) version
Используемую версию узнать легко:
  Version7 = 7000,
  Version8 = 8000,
  Version8Standards = 8888,
  Version9 = 9000,
  Version9Standards = 9999,
  Version10 = 10000,
  Version10Standards = 10001,
  Version11 = 11000,
  Version11Edge = 11001
Если у вас IE9, то впишите 9999, если версия IE10 - впишите 10001, или 11001 в случае 11-ой версии экплорера.

Работа со слоями в редакторе интуитивно понятна - верхнее окно это CSS стили, это HTML код. В списках справа варианты стилей и кода - количество вариантов слоя это и есть количество стилей к количеству вариантов кода. То есть, если слой имеет 3 варианта стиля и 2 варианта кода, то на выходе получится комбинация из 6 разных вариантов.

Создавать новые варианты не всегда целесообразно, порой можно обойтись макросами вариации #[text1|text2|text3]#. По щелчку правой кнопки доступна вставка всех существущих макросов.

Кроме макроса вариации есть макросы:

  • Случайная строка из файла
  • Содержимое из случайного файла
  • Случайное имя файла из директории

Ниже пример работы макроса вставки случайной строки из файла. Этот пример можно скачать по этой ссылке. Макросы доступны из контекстного меню в редакторах кода и стилей.






Ширина рисунка задается принудительно в главном окне программы. Высота может быть вариативна - либо фиксирована, либо высчитана автоматически по результату рассчета вариантов получаемых изображений.

Количество получаемых изображений из созданных слоев внизу программы и считается по простой формуле - количество слоев х количество вариантов кода х количество вариантов стилей к этому коду.

Сохраняя рисунки можно указать ограничение по количеству и/или перемешать перед сохранением. К примеру - если количество вариантов 1000, а нам нужны только 100..... Перемешивание нужно для того, чтобы при таком сохранении было наибошльшее визуальное разнообразие. 

Для удобства, в программе есть горячие кнопки, которые пересчитают количество получившихся вариантов в редактируемом слое. Если используются макросы для работы с файлами, то такой пересчет может занять некторое время.

Важный момент - для ускорения работы программа считывает все используемые в макросах файлы в память, и, в последствии, уже работает с памятью - это сильно увеличивает скорость обработки. Если вам необходимо перечитать файлы, в случае их изменения, то необходимо из меню

Лицензия

Незарегестрированная версия сохраняет не более 5 результирующих изображений.

Лицензии привязывается к серийному номеру компьютера. Если необходимо перенести программу на другое железо, напишите мне сообщение с указанием своего почтового адреса и серийного номера - я вышлю новый ключ.

Стоимость лицензии  90000 р Приобрести лицензию.

(все верно, цена именно такая. данная программа больше не продается) 

Версия

Текущая версия программы 1.6

Скачать myImageGenerator 1.6